你查询的IP:[123.206.236.24]  地理位置:中国–上海–上海

最新查询210.26.110.204 202.96.116.171 58.144.225.253 125.96.172.157 116.192.105.68 221.12.179.181 119.32.170.175 124.67.201.218 222.192.95.117 123.206.236.24 162.105.137.154 122.131.128.131 202.124.24.34 122.168.128.194 116.212.160.178 122.152.192.95 202.142.16.117 119.88.95.254 121.58.91.91 202.91.176.46 61.28.107.54 123.253.162.28 119.128.181.45 114.60.53.57 117.121.128.227 220.234.141.46 119.4.145.43 210.12.173.88 202.38.156.60 202.149.160.191 210.26.113.202